CAUTION TO GOOD TEMPLARS

At a public meeting held at the City of the Plain some months past an enthusiastic teetotaler was extolling the advantages of total abstinence, and, in his exuberant flow of language, was led astray, and spoke of himself in somewhat the following terms :—" Now, my friends, look carefully at me, here am I just verging upon sixty years of age, and have never tasted a drop of intoxicating liquor all my life. Look at me full of muscular strength, fall of activity, and in good health. Now, my friends, follow my example, and, as a matter of course, you will all enjoy the same result." This was thought to be a most conclusive argument. But, judge of their surprise, when a great burly looking man, looking as if his face had just received a coat of vermillion, toddled to the front, and spoke as follows:—"That last fellow's

my brother, old boys, its all right though what he said, I know he is too meai) to buy a glass of beer, but he is no better for that. JNow, just look at me mycock-a-lor-ums. I'm now five years older than him, and never went to bed quite sober for the last twenty years, and, as far as muscle, just look at that yellar looking chap, he don't look like a brother of mine. See, lam as round as a tub, and as for strength, I could just pitch him over a hay stack, hear that now." Exit, singing " For I'm a jolly good fellow," beating time with his stick on the platfrom.
